Drank on tap at Brewer's Alley in Frederick, MD. Taken from notes:

Appearance: Copper-pumpkin in color, average lacing, little head.

Smell: Huge cocoa nibs on the nose with a side dish of lightly-toasted malts.

Taste: Same as aroma. Just. Beautiful.

Mouthfeel: Deep cocoa on the palate, dissipates quickly, so you need to taste several times to enjoy the chocolate flavor as it will not stick to the palate well.

Drinkability: Fantastic session beer and my first non-stout, non-porter chocolate beer.
